Football Preview: Northside Christian Mustangs vs. Seminole Warhawks
The Northside Christian Mustangs's homestand will continue as they prepare to take on the Seminole Warhawks at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Both come into the matchup b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
Northside Christian will roll into the game after a wild two-game stretch: they only put up seven points on October 4th, then bounced right back against Indian Rocks Christian on Friday. Northside Christian came out on top against Indian Rocks Christian by a score of 31-22. The win was a breath of fresh air for the Mustangs as it put an end to their three-game losing streak.
Meanwhile, Seminole owes their defense a big pat on the back after their performance on Friday. They simply couldn't be stopped as they easily beat Pasco 28-0 on the road. The Warhawks might be getting used to big wins seeing as the team has won four matches by 20 points or more this season.
Mason Starke was his usual excellent self, rushing for 137 yards and two touchdowns, while also picking up 62 receiving yards and a touchdown. He didn't just play on offense: he also made four total tackles and defended two passes in addition to snagging two interceptions.
Seminole was unstoppable on the ground and finished the game with 251 rushing yards.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now rushed for at least 194 rushing yards in eight consecutive contests dating back to last season.
Seminole didn't go easy on the quarterback and picked off three passes before the game was over. The picks came courtesy of Starke and Brody Tunison.
Northside Christian now has a winning record of 4-3. As for Seminole, their victory bumped their record up to 5-2.
